]> git.pld-linux.org Git - packages/LPRngTool.git/blob - LPRngTool.spec
- removed all Group fields translations (oure rpm now can handle translating
[packages/LPRngTool.git] / LPRngTool.spec
1 Summary:        LPRngTool - printer configuration, monitoring and management utility with GUI for LPRng
2 Summary(pl):    LPRngTool jest narzêdziem do monitorowania i zarz±dzania systemem druku LPRng
3 Name:           LPRngTool
4 Version:        1.2.7
5 Release:        1
6 License:        GPL
7 Group:          Applications/Publishing
8 Source0:        ftp://ftp.astart.com/pub/LPRng/LPRngTool/%{name}-%{version}.tgz
9 BuildRequires:  autoconf
10 BuildRequires:  automake
11 Requires:       ghostscript
12 Requires:       tcl
13 Requires:       tk >= 1.50
14 Requires:       LPRng >= 3.7
15 Requires:       ifhp >= 3.4
16 Obsoletes:      printtool
17 BuildRoot:      %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
18
19 %define         _wmconfig       /etc/X11/wmconfig
20 %define         _controlpanel   /usr/lib/rhs/control-panel
21 %define         _filterdir      /usr/lib/filters
22 %define         _rhfilterdir    %{_filterdir}/rhs
23 %define         _prefix         /usr/X11R6
24
25 %description
26 LPRngTool is a printer configuration and print queue monitoring and
27 management utility with a graphical user interface. LPRngTool is
28 similar to Red Hat's 'printtool', but includes most of the additional
29 functions of LPRng (including printer pooling, printer redirection,
30 job accounting, etc), and the 'lpc' facilities for local and remote
31 queue management and monitoring. LPRngTool works with SMB, Windows, HP
32 JetDirect, locally-attached, and unfiltered printers and print queues.
33
34 %description -l pl
35 LPRngTool to narzêdzie do konfiguracji drukarki, monitorowania i
36 zarz±dzania kolejk± wydruku z graficznym interfejsem u¿ytkownika. Jest
37 podobne do RedHatowego printtoola, ale zwiera wiêkszo¶æ dodatkowych
38 funkcji LPRng (w tym przekierowanie drukarek, przydzielanie prac
39 itp.), oraz udogodnienia lpc do monitorowania i zarz±dzania lokalnymi
40 oraz zdalnymi kolejkami. LPRngTool dzia³a z drukarkami i kolejkami
41 SMB, Windows, HP JetDirect, lokalnie pod³±czonymi i niefiltrowanymi.
42
43 %prep
44 %setup -q
45
46 %build
47 #CFLAGS=%{rpmcflags} 
48 aclocal
49 autoconf
50 %configure \
51         --with-lprngtool_conf=%{_sysconfdir}/lprngtool.conf \
52         --with-printcap_path=%{_sysconfdir}/printcap \
53         --with-spool_directory=/var/spool/lpd  \
54         --with-ifhp_path=%{_filterdir}/ifhp \
55         --with-filterdir=%{_filterdir} \
56         --with-rhfilterdir=%{_rhfilterdir} \
57         --with-gsupdir=%{_datadir}/ghostscript \
58         --with-userid=lp \
59         --with-groupid=lp 
60 %{__make}
61
62 %install
63 rm -rf $RPM_BUILD_ROOT
64 install -d $RPM_BUILD_ROOT{%{_wmconfig},%{_bindir},%{_controlpanel},%{_filterdir}}
65 install -d $RPM_BUILD_ROOT{%{_rhfilterdir},%{_sysconfdir},%{_mandir},%{_mandir}/man1}
66
67 %{__make} DESTDIR=$RPM_BUILD_ROOT install
68
69 install lprngtool.wmconfig $RPM_BUILD_ROOT%{_wmconfig}/lprngtool  
70 install lprngtool.init $RPM_BUILD_ROOT%{_controlpanel}/lprngtool.init
71 install lprngtool.xpm  $RPM_BUILD_ROOT%{_controlpanel}/lprngtool.xpm
72
73 gzip -9nf README CHANGES INSTALL
74
75 %clean
76 rm -rf $RPM_BUILD_ROOT
77
78 %files
79 %defattr(644,root,root,755)
80 %doc *.gz
81 %attr(0755,root,root) %{_bindir}/*
82 %{_controlpanel}/lprngtool.init
83 %{_controlpanel}/lprngtool.xpm
84 %attr(0644,root,root)   %config            %{_sysconfdir}/lprngtool.conf
85 %attr(0644,root,root)                      %{_sysconfdir}/lprngtool.conf.sample
86 %attr(0644,root,root)   %config(missingok) %{_wmconfig}/lprngtool
87 %{_mandir}/man1/*.1*
88 %dir %{_rhfilterdir}
89 %{_rhfilterdir}/*
This page took 0.043802 seconds and 4 git commands to generate.